> What gives you that idea? .... PE has a different purpose than XE.
>
> PE is a cost effective single user license with all features and options
> of the EE (except RAC) that gives an easy way to purchase Support. Target
> is developers.
>
> XE is a cost effective multi user license with few features and no
> options, supported by the community. Target is Small to Medium Businesses
> who have been turning to MS Access or MySQL because Oracle has been seen
> as expensive. HTML DB can easily challenge MS Access.
